I've just bought a bike and when you pick the rear end up there is some movement before the wheel comes off the ground. My question is, is it the du bushes need replacing or what? Any help would be great. Rob

Take the shock completely out and remove the rear wheel.Run the frame through it,s travel and also check side to side.You'll feel if anything is a miss. 😉
